Hi guys, there's a strong chance this is user error as I've only just started using my REMEMOrizer, but it starts up fine in CP/M via the VGA connection, but when I type "MTXL" to (I think!) switch to BASIC, I get "No file, changing to MTX512 status" with a stuck flashing cursor. No display appears on my TV, and I think I've tuned it in correctly (it was working before on this TV before I installed the REMEMOrizer).
Help appreciated!

Hi Andy,
you are using the MTX output, rather than REMEMOrizer VGA output, at that point are you?
The "No File" just means that you have not selected a game file to run on the CP/M command line, it should still drop to the normal "Ready" prompt on the 40 coulmn screen, ie., the MTX TV or Composite Video output

Re: Can't change to MTX Basic
Go on, get your dirty laundry out in public
We won't laugh any more than we are now
Let me see, composite video plugged into the wrong socket on either the MTX (in the audio "Hi-Fi" output) or the telly,
trying to use composite video from the MTX, but have the TV switched to the UHF aerial/tuner mode,
trying to use the UHF aerial/tuner input, but have the telly switched to the Aux / composite video input,
not actually having the same lead plugged into both the MTX and the telly!
And of course, when the MTX switches to it's internal VDP, the display on the VGA "freezes" making you think that there is a problem.
